The role of social media copywriting in website promotion
06/09/2023

Social media has become an integral part of our daily lives. We use it to connect with friends and family, share our thoughts and experiences, and discover new content. It has also become a powerful tool for businesses to promote their websites and reach a wider audience. In this article, we will explore the role of social media copywriting in website promotion and how it can help businesses drive traffic and increase conversions.

What is Social Media Copywriting?

Social media copywriting refers to the art of writing persuasive and engaging content for social media platforms. It involves crafting catchy headlines, compelling captions, and attention-grabbing call-to-actions that encourage users to click, like, share, and take desired actions on a website. Good social media copywriting can help businesses stand out from the competition, capture the attention of their target audience, and ultimately drive traffic to their website.

Driving Traffic to Your Website

One of the primary goals of social media copywriting is to drive traffic to your website. By creating compelling content that resonates with your target audience, you can attract more users to visit your website. This can be achieved through various strategies:

1. Creating Shareable Content

When crafting social media posts, it is important to create content that people would want to share with their friends and followers. This can be achieved by focusing on creating valuable and informative content that provides solutions to common problems or answers to frequently asked questions. By sharing this type of content, your audience becomes your brand advocates and helps spread the word about your website.

2. Using Compelling Visuals

Visual content is more likely to be shared and engaged with on social media platforms. Incorporating eye-catching images, videos, and infographics can significantly increase the chances of your content being shared and driving traffic to your website. Make sure to optimize your visuals for each social media platform to maximize their impact.

3. Including Call-to-Actions

A call-to-action (CTA) is a statement that encourages users to take a specific action, such as visiting your website, signing up for a newsletter, or making a purchase. Including clear and compelling CTAs in your social media copywriting can help guide users towards your website and increase the chances of conversion. Make sure to use action verbs and create a sense of urgency to motivate your audience to take action.

4. Engaging with Your Audience

Social media is all about creating connections and engaging with your audience. Responding to comments, addressing concerns, and actively participating in conversations can help build trust and establish a strong online presence. By engaging with your audience, you can drive more traffic to your website as people become more interested in what you have to offer.

Increasing Conversions on Your Website

Driving traffic to your website is only half the battle. The ultimate goal is to convert those visitors into customers or clients. Social media copywriting can play a crucial role in increasing conversions on your website:

1. Crafting Compelling Landing Page Copy

A landing page is a standalone page on your website that is designed to convert visitors into leads or customers. The copy on your landing page should be persuasive and compelling, clearly conveying the value of your product or service and encouraging visitors to take the desired action. Social media copywriting can help create attention-grabbing headlines, persuasive bullet points, and compelling calls-to-action on your landing page.

2. Highlighting Customer Testimonials and Reviews

Social proof is a powerful motivator for potential customers. Including customer testimonials and reviews on your website can help build trust and credibility. Social media copywriting can be used to highlight positive customer experiences and encourage visitors to take the desired action based on the positive feedback from others.

3. Creating Persuasive Product Descriptions

When selling products online, the copywriting plays a crucial role in persuading visitors to make a purchase. Social media copywriting can help create compelling product descriptions that highlight the features and benefits of your products, address common objections, and create a sense of urgency to drive conversions.

4. Implementing A/B Testing

Social media platforms provide a wealth of data and insights that can be used to optimize your website for conversions. By conducting A/B tests on different social media copywriting variations, you can identify the most effective messaging and optimize your website's copy to increase conversions. This can include testing different headlines, CTAs, and overall messaging to find what resonates best with your target audience.

Conclusion

Social media copywriting plays a crucial role in website promotion. It helps businesses drive traffic to their website, increase brand awareness, and ultimately convert visitors into customers or clients. By creating shareable content, using compelling visuals, including strong CTAs, and engaging with your audience, you can leverage social media to promote your website and achieve your business goals. Remember to constantly analyze and optimize your social media copywriting efforts based on website traffic analysis, user feedback, and performance monitoring to ensure the best results.
